My Buying Guides on Projector Ceiling Mount Drop Ceiling

1. Why I Consider a Drop Ceiling Mount

When I look for a projector ceiling mount for a drop ceiling, my first priority is stability. A drop ceiling is not the same as a solid drywall or concrete ceiling, so I always want a mount that is specifically designed to work with ceiling tiles and grid systems. In my experience, the right mount helps me keep the projector secure, aligned, and easy to adjust.

2. What I Check Before Buying

Before I buy, I always check a few important things:

  • The weight capacity of the mount
  • Compatibility with my projector model
  • Whether it fits standard ceiling grid systems
  • Adjustable height or drop length
  • Tilt, swivel, and rotation options
  • Build quality and material strength

I have found that skipping these checks can lead to installation problems later.

3. Importance of Weight Capacity

One of the first things I look at is how much weight the mount can hold. My projector may not be very heavy, but I still prefer a mount with a higher weight rating than I actually need. That gives me extra peace of mind and better long-term reliability.

4. Compatibility With My Projector

I always make sure the mount matches my projector’s mounting pattern. Some projectors use universal mounting arms, while others need a specific bracket. If I do not confirm this ahead of time, I risk buying a mount that does not fit properly.

5. Adjustability Matters to Me

I like mounts that let me adjust the projector after installation. Small changes in tilt, angle, and rotation make a big difference in picture alignment. For me, easy adjustability saves time and makes setup much less frustrating.

6. Drop Length and Ceiling Height

Since I am dealing with a drop ceiling, I pay close attention to the drop length. I want the projector to hang low enough for proper image placement, but not so low that it becomes awkward or unsafe. I always measure my room height and screen position before choosing a mount.

7. Installation and Safety

In my experience, safety is just as important as convenience. I look for mounts that include clear instructions, secure hardware, and a design meant for suspended ceilings. If I am unsure about installation, I prefer to get professional help rather than risk damaging the ceiling or projector.

8. Material and Build Quality

I usually prefer steel or heavy-duty metal construction because it feels more durable to me. A strong finish also helps resist wear over time. When a mount feels solid, I trust it more for long-term use.

9. Cable Management Features

I appreciate mounts that help hide or organize cables. A cleaner setup looks more professional and reduces clutter. In my experience, built-in cable management also makes maintenance easier.
